> > I am looking for a way to deal with the issue that the list of supported
> > mimetypes for some programs depends on the installed i/o plugins. E,g,
> > Marble and most Calligra programs have this problem.
> > 
> > Simply hardcoding all possibly supported mimetypes only leaves bad
> > impressions if a program is started for a file after e.g. a click on the
> > file in the file manager, but then gives an error message after starting
> > that it cannot read the file.
> > 
> > It is not only about the i/o plugins created at build time. But some
> > distributions also tend to put single i/o plugins in different packages,
> > so
> > just updating the "Mimetype=" entry in the .desktop file on build-time (by
> > generating another .desktop file) before it is installed will not work for
> > these.
> > 
> > So how can this problem be solved?
> 
> Do what okular does (i.e. one desktop per plugin)

Thanks, Albert. Works also at least for Marble (not yet commited, but 
preparing review request right now, then going to apply solution for Calligra 
as well).
